Harnham is hiring a Product Manager to lead onboarding, activation, and identity verification for a growing fintech wallet. This role focuses on improving user conversion and engagement across multiple regions.

The ideal candidate will have 5-6+ years in product management, particularly in fintech, and experience with KYC flows. Additional skills include strong analytics and a background in B2C mobile products.
